Aimpoint COA – The Next Step in Pistol Optics

Welcome back to the show. Today, we’re talking about one of the most anticipated optics collaborations in years—the Aimpoint COA, short for Clever Optics Advancement. Built in partnership with Glock, this new red dot aims to change the game for concealed carry and duty pistols.

So, what makes it so different? First, the design. Instead of moving an inner tube like the Acro P2, the COA moves the emitter itself. That means the optic is slimmer, lighter, and yet still keeps the same big, clear 15mm viewing window shooters loved on the Acro. It’s fully enclosed, runs on a standard CR2032 battery with five years of life, and is tested to survive everything from deep water to extreme cold and heat.

Second, the software. You get 12 brightness settings—four for night vision, eight for daylight—and an automated step-down system that saves battery life if you forget to adjust it. Plus, there’s a clever two-press lockout feature, so you won’t accidentally bump brightness levels while carrying.

But maybe the biggest leap forward is the new A-Cut mounting system. Think of it like a ski boot wedge—it locks the optic into the slide without relying on screws to absorb recoil forces. The result? No loose screws, no shifting, and a lower mount that lets you co-witness with standard-height iron sights. It’s secure, simple, and durable enough for 40,000 rounds.

The catch? For the first year, the COA will be exclusive to Glock Gen 5 packages, starting with models like the G43X, G48, G19, G45, and G47. Prices range from just over a thousand dollars for the slimline models to around $1,165 for the full-size setups. After 12 months, Aimpoint will open the system up to other manufacturers.

Bottom line: Aimpoint and Glock aren’t just making another red dot. They’re delivering a package that solves the headaches shooters have had for years—fitment, screws, durability, and battery life. The COA and A-Cut system might just set a new standard for pistol optics moving forward.
